plc学者
级别: 略有小成
精华主题: 0
发帖数量: 191 个
工控威望: 362 点
下载积分: 3391 分
在线时间: 376(小时)
注册时间: 2011-07-18
最后登录: 2024-11-25
查看plc学者的 主题 / 回贴
楼主  发表于: 2011-12-05 20:35
师傅们能不能给我讲讲三菱plc数据结构的规则,像16位数据,32位数据,他们怎么转换的
toutianjian
级别: 网络英雄
精华主题: 0
发帖数量: 241 个
工控威望: 5067 点
下载积分: 66606 分
在线时间: 364(小时)
注册时间: 2008-03-20
最后登录: 2024-11-29
查看toutianjian的 主题 / 回贴
1楼  发表于: 2011-12-09 15:44
你说的是16位,32位的数据转换吧!16位的数据你用乘以1或者除以1做一次运算,然后把运算后的数据直接跳到32位运算里,数据不会出错(溢出之类的)。mul d20 k1 d30       dadd d30 d60 d80
设D20=100  在程序监控可以看到在32位运算里D30的值还是100
本帖最近评分记录:
  • 下载积分:+3(plc学者) 热心助人